When it comes to borrowing money, it is important to have a loan agreement in place. A loan agreement is a legal document that outlines the terms and conditions of a loan, including the interest rate, payment schedule, and any collateral that may be used to secure the loan. It is essential for both the borrower and the lender to have a loan agreement in place to protect their interests and ensure that the loan is repaid according to the terms agreed upon.

If you are considering entering into a loan agreement, it may be in your best interest to consult with a loan agreement lawyer. A loan agreement lawyer is a legal professional who specializes in helping clients draft, review, and negotiate loan agreements. Here are some reasons why you may want to consider working with a loan agreement lawyer:

1. Protect Your Interests – A loan agreement lawyer can help you ensure that the loan agreement is fair and equitable. They can review the terms of the loan agreement and make sure that they are in your best interest. This includes ensuring that the interest rate is reasonable, the payment schedule is manageable, and any collateral requirements are fair.

2. Avoid Legal Issues – A loan agreement lawyer can help you avoid legal issues that may arise from a poorly drafted loan agreement. They can ensure that the loan agreement complies with all applicable laws and regulations, and that it is legally binding.

3. Negotiate Terms – If you are borrowing money from a lender, a loan agreement lawyer can help you negotiate the terms of the loan agreement. They can help you get the best possible terms based on your financial situation and creditworthiness.

4. Ensure Accuracy – A loan agreement lawyer can help you ensure that all the details of the loan agreement are accurate. This includes ensuring that the loan amount, interest rate, and payment schedule are correct.
